In 1739, William Arnett Martin BIBB entered the world in Hanover, Virginia, USA, born to Thomas Kettle Bibb Iii And Sarah Martin. In 1783, William Arnett Martin BIBB resided in No Township Listed, Amherst County, VA. William Arnett Martin BIBB married Elizabeth Butler, Elizabeth Marr Bibb, Mary Thompson, Nancy Parrock, Sarah Sally Smith Wyatt, Sarah Bluebucket, and had children including Benajah Smith Bibb Judge, Benjamin Smith Bibb, Cordelia Bibb, Deliah Bibb, Dorothy Celia Bibb, Dr Joseph Wyatt Bibb, Dr William Wyatt Bibb Us Congressman 1St Gov Of Alabama, Elizabeth Bibb, Elizabeth Bibb Johnson, Henry Bibb, Irena Green, James Bibb, Jesse Bibb, John Bibb, John Danridge Bibb, Kesiah Keziah Bibb, Lucy Bibb, Lucy Dorathea Bibb, Martha Dandridge Nancy Bibb, Martin Bibb, Mary M Bibb, Nancy Bibb, Nancy Catherine Bibb, Payton Bibb, Peggy Bibb Bryant, Randolph Carter Bibb, Sallie Bibb, Sarah Sally Bibb Cash Barnett, Sarah Booker Bibb, Susanna Bibb Wright, Susannah Bibb, Suzannah Elizabeth Bibb, Thomas Bibb, William Arnett Bibb, William Thomas Babb. William Arnett Martin BIBB passed away in 1793 in Amherst, Amherst, Virginia, United States.
